
Ruben Sim's ‘Twitter stress' excuse backfires as fan comments, 'Maybe don't use your phone while driving?' and many agree
Ruben Sim, a popular YouTuber who is known for Roblox gaming and his critic videos, has sparked significant online backlash. The criticism began after his deliberate attempt to deflect the blame for a driving mishap onto his Twitter followers.
As he claimed, the online interactions (as he checked his phone while driving) caused him to crash. The excuse, though, drew widespread condemnation and brought blunt safety reminders from the audience and more. The entire incident even sparked widespread criticism, with the online community refusing to accept his excuse.

Sim took on X, describing the entire mishap with a palpable frustration. His post, which showed the car in question to have been in an accident, came with a comment. It read,
'Are you fucking happy? Twitter has been really stressing me out lately and I slid into a curb while checking my mentions. You people are evil."
The explicit admission coming from Sim clearly blamed his audience for his stress. As per his comments, stress led him to use the phone while he was driving, and it caused a subsequent crash. The entire blame game became a focal point of some intense criticism received by the YouTuber. A user bluntly replied,
'Maybe don't use your phone while driving?'
Sim's attempt to shift responsibility backfired quite spectacularly.
Instead of gaining sympathy, the core issue that his fans seized upon was his own dangerous action, making active use of a phone while he was operating a vehicle. The fundamental message echoing across many X user comments was crystal clear—distracted driving was the problem and not the Twitter mentions. Fans even went ahead to demand personal accountability from Sim for his reckless behaviour.

Best Moveset for Aegislash in Pokemon GO: Comprehensive PvP and PvE Guide
Aegislash in Pokemon GO (Image via The Pokemon Company) Aegislash has finally made its debut in Pokémon GO, and it's already stirring up buzz across the PvP and PvE communities. This Steel/Ghost-type Pokémon brings a unique mechanic—its stance-changing ability—that gives it an unpredictable edge in battle. But is it worth the investment? Let's break down the best moveset, strengths and weaknesses, and how Aegislash performs across various formats. Pokemon GO Aegislash Overview - Typing: Steel / Ghost - Forms: Blade Forme (attack-focused) and Shield Forme (defense-focused) - Max CP: Around 1,800 (varies based on IVs and league level) - Resistances: Nine resistances, including double to Poison and triple to Normal - Weaknesses: Fire, Ground, Dark, and Ghost-type moves Its dual typing and stance mechanic make Aegislash a standout with both offensive and defensive potential, especially in PvP. Best Moveset for Aegislash in Pokemon GO Picking the right moveset is crucial to unlocking Aegislash's full potential. Fast Move Charged Move Best Use Case Fury Cutter Shadow Ball Optimal for PvP and PvE Psycho Cut Shadow Ball Solid alternative in PvE Why This Moveset Works for Aegislash in Pokemon GO - Fury Cutter offers fast energy generation, enabling frequent use of high-damage charge moves. - Shadow Ball is the go-to choice for damage, benefiting from STAB and strong coverage. - Psycho Cut is a secondary fast move with fast energy gain but lacks type synergy.
